With an adept understanding of ceramics and anatomy,Hong-Kong based artist Johnson Tsang creates strange and unexpected anthropomorphicsculptures where human forms seem to splash effortlessly through functionalobjects like bowls, plates, and cups. While the works shown here are mostlyinnocent and comical in nature the artist is unafraid of veering into moremacabre subject matter in other artworks that grapple with war and violence.
Tsang recently opened a solo show, Living Clay, at the YinggeCeramics Museum in Taiwan that runs through January 19, 2014.
